On Mon, Jun 11, 2018 at 6:30 PM Robin Sommer <ro...@icir.org> wrote: > Confirmed that I'm still seeing that difference even when using the > options to turn the stores. Tried it on two different Fedora 28 > systems, with similar results.
I had previously tried on a Fedora 28 VM w/ 4 CPUs and didn't reproduce it, but trying again on a system with 32 CPUs, I can reproduce your results. This has lead to the fix/workaround at [1], now in master, which should bring things back to baseline when not using data stores and more sane timings when using them. General changes/improvements in CAF itself may be warranted here because I can recreate the same performance overhead if I artificially remove all broker functionality from Bro, but then simply create and never use a caf::actor_system via the default configuration. - Jon [1] https://github.com/bro/bro/commit/c9fe9a943c4d78b18ffbae13c562b93349a5f951 _______________________________________________ bro-dev mailing list bro-dev@bro.org http://mailman.icsi.berkeley.edu/mailman/listinfo/bro-dev